Can I order online and collect in-store?

Yes, you can order online and collect your purchases in-store at Pets at Home. This service, known as Click & Collect, allows you to shop online and pick up your items from a local store. Pets at Home offers a One Hour Click & Collect service, enabling you to collect your order within an hour of placing it online. To use this service, visit the Pets at Home website, select your items, and choose the Click & Collect option at checkout. You'll receive a notification when your order is ready for collection. Please note that availability may vary by store, so it's advisable to check the specific store's details before placing your order.

Are pets allowed in Pets at Home stores?

Yes, Pets at Home stores are pet-friendly and welcome well-behaved dogs. You can bring your dog into the store, provided they are kept on a lead and under control at all times. This policy allows you to shop for pet supplies while your dog accompanies you. Please ensure your dog is well-behaved to maintain a pleasant environment for all customers.
